Features
Steady your boat while trolling and slow your boat's rate of drift, even in windy conditions. By stabilizing your drifting angle, the Drift Sock allows you to float longer over fish-holding areas. Constructed of vinyl-reinforced nylon with 1" nylon straps. Vented design allows easy retrieval from water.

Very happy with my purchase
I bought the drift socks for fishing Lake Erie for walleye. I can't believe I have fished over 20 years on the lake without one. It really works great. I can now control the angle of the boat when I drift so more lines can be put out. When trolling, I can control the speed depending on conditions. I use one sock and if the speed is still too fast I use another sock on the opposite side. The sock is cone shaped with a small opening at the end that allows the water to escape when you pull it from the water, it sure beats those heavy 5 gallon buckets I used in the past. I also noticed that when we were fishing in high waves we did not get bounced all over the place like we did before using the sock.It really stablized the boat. i have a lund 1983 tyee 5.3. with a johnson 115 and a 9.9 kicker. what size wind sock will i need?
The 36" drift anchor is intended for boats 18'-21' in length, while the 30" drift anchor is intended for boat lengths 16'-18'.
